Soviet Spacecraft Burns Up
Reuters
MOSCOW —
The Soviet cargo spacecraft Progress-37 burned up on re-entry to the atmosphere Friday after ferrying supplies to the manned Mir orbiting station, the official Tass news agency reported. The cargo craft was launched to Mir on July 19. It delivered water, food and mail to cosmonauts Vladimir Titov and Musa Manarov and refueled their space laboratory.
